Norwich City Overcome Queens Park Rangers, Start 2026 With Victory In Championship
Philippe Clement shuffled the pack from the defeat at home to Watford, with José Cordoba, Ben Chrisene, and Matej Jurásek coming in to start at Loftus Road.
It took until the 15th minute for the first chance to be registered, as Steve Cook glanced a header narrowly wide of Vladan Kovacevic's post for the hosts. Kovacevic was called into action on the half-hour mark, saving well with his legs after an effort from Rumarn Burrell. Jurasek came close to opening the scoring for the Canaries, but his shot was palmed out for a corner by Paul Nardi.
